Pricing

Gracious Haven Edgemont offers competitive pricing for its accommodations compared to regional and state averages. For a semi-private room, residents can expect to pay $2,500 per month, which is notably lower than the average costs of $2,805 in Pima County and $2,820 across Arizona. Similarly, the monthly rate for a private room at Gracious Haven Edgemont is set at $3,000, again offering substantial savings compared to the county's average of $3,332 and the state's average of $3,345. These pricing advantages not only reflect an appealing value proposition but also ensure that quality care remains accessible to those seeking comfortable living arrangements.

Room TypeGracious Haven EdgemontPima CountyArizona
Semi-Private$2,500$2,805$2,820
Private$3,000$3,332$3,345

  • does medicare cover hospiceComprehensive Guide to Medicare Coverage for Hospice Care

    Hospice care focuses on providing comfort and support for individuals nearing the end of life, with Medicare Part A covering services like nursing care and counseling for patients with a terminal illness and a life expectancy of six months or less. While most hospice services are low-cost for eligible patients, families should be aware that certain expenses, such as room and board, may not be covered.
